Living Will
What are Living Wills?
A living will is simply a legal directive which instructs how
much artificial life support you wish to receive if you fall into an
irreversible coma or persistent vegetative state. It outlines very
specific directives for medical care.
A living will also provides for the appointment of a guardian or
health care surrogate. A health care surrogate is a person you
designate to make medical decision on your behalf in the event you
are unable to make those decisions for yourself. You can also
establish an alternate surrogate in case your first choice is unable
to serve in that capacity.
Like any will, a living will can be revoked at any time. You can
revoke it by destroying it or by communicating to a witness, an
attending physician or other health care provider that you revoke
it.
But, Why have a Living Will?
The Schiavo case illustrates the heartache and legal wrangling
that can take place without a legal directive. A living will
provides written directives and documentation to ensure your wishes
are executed, the person you wish to represent your interests is not
challenged, your family and loved ones are spared doubt, guilt and
divisiveness, along with emotional pain, and undue legal expenses.
More than ever, individuals need to be scrupulous about having a
written directive readily available so that their choices are
carried out and their loved ones are spared as much pain as
possible.
